Getting from Lisbon Airport (LIS) to central Lisbon
Lisbon Airport is roughly 8 kilometres from central Lisbon. The drive time takes about 20 minutes.
If you're using public transport, expect a journey of about 25 minutes.
When to fly to Lisbon Airport (LIS)
August is the busiest month for flights from Delhi Indira Gandhi International Airport to Lisbon Airport. For a quieter experience, travel to Lisbon in March.
The warmest month in Lisbon is August, with temperatures ranging between 16ºC (61ºF) and 29ºC (84ºF). Book your flights from Delhi Indira Gandhi International Airport to Lisbon Airport in this month if you like this kind of weather.
Look for cheap tickets from DEL to LIS in January if you want to travel in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est around then, ranging between 8ºC (46ºF) and 16ºC (61ºF) on average.
Explore more of Portugal
Porto is just one of the many places in Portugal waiting to be explored once you've seen Lisbon. Around 274 kilometres away to the north, top sights here include Ribeira District, Rio Douro and Livraria Lello.
If you're ready to explore another major destination in Portugal, head for Amadora, about 8 kilometres north-west of Lisbon. Roman Villa, Park Fantasia and Palácio dos Condes da Lousã are key highlights.
